The Gambino family got its name from previous boss Carlo Gambino who controlled the family from 1959 until his death in October 1976. Throughout the history of the Italian-American Mafia, the largest families were the ones organized by Salvatore Maranzano in 1931 in New York.He organized the families after he was victorious in a mob war for the streets of New York called the Castellammarese War.
